How many times larger is the volume of a cone if the radius is multiplied by 6?
yan [13]

Answer:

36 times larger.

Step-by-step explanation:

V= \pi *r^{2}*\frac{h}{3} is the original volume of a cone formula.

If the radius is multiplied by 6 the new formula is:

V= \pi *(6x)^{2} * \frac{4}{3}

Which is simplified to:

V= \pi *36r^2*\frac{h}{3}

The only difference between the simplified formula and the original is the *36 so the new volume is 36 times larger when the radius is multiplied by 6.
